7th Grade

Number 5, Jordyn Porter, began Wednesday night's 7th and 8th grade volleyball double header against Addison. First to serve for Manchester's Lady Dutch 7th grade team, Jordyn landed 3 aces before Addison gained possession. Manchester's  team communication and ability to control the ball upon receiving a serve allowed them to immediately recover possession for the whole of set one; which the Lady Dutch soundly won at 21-7.

Addison served first in set two, and was able to capitalize for a quick lead, one of only two times they would lead during the 7th grade matches that night. Tied 4-4 number 24, Elizabeth Burch, knocked over two aces and Manchester got its momentum back and rolled on to a 21-11 win.

Set three, although Manchester lead throughout, remained close to the end. Both teams played their best game of the night with almost every service leading to 3 hit volleys. For a moment Addison seemed poised to take the upset. A beautiful spike from #13, Morgan Lutton, took the fight out of Addison. Manchester kept it together and took the match, 21-17. Manchester ended the 7th grade match 3-0.

The "Home" side of the bleachers were full for all of the 7th grade match, and by the time the 8th grade Lady Dutch took the court Manchester's spectators had spilled into the "Visitor" section. Set one was a battle. Both teams displayed great control; back lines digging deep to keep the other team from getting more then 2 serves in a row. Finally  #6, Victoria Woods, served Manchester to the biggest score gap of the match taking the Lady Dutch from 12 to 17, putting them 7 points above Addison. Manchester couldn't hang on for the lead though, and Addison squeaked by with a 19-21 win.

That win would be the last time Addison led that night. Sets 2 and 3 both saw Manchester putting up big leads, 8-0 and 10-0 before Addison got their first point. Kayla Ridenour #11, and #15 Katelyn Blumenauer's serves were too powerful for Addison to handle. Although there were many long volleys, Manchester's ability to communicate on the court kept them firmly in the lead for the last two sets. 21-13 was the final for set 2. A perfectly executed bump-set-spike by Manchester ended set 3, a 21-11 win. The Lady Dutch won the match 2-1. The 7th and 8th grade played smart on Wednesday night. Manchester's volleyball talent runs deep.
